Outward Appearance

Fairn has a dark complexion which makes his pale blue eyes stand out in contrast. His hair is dark but with brighter highlights during the summer season. He is of average hight and fit from years of manual labour as a fisherman of the Lake. He laughs easily and seems to be carefree, even when faced with problems like a dwindling purse and unemployment. He is well mannered and polite, something his mother takes great pride in.

Background

Fairns father ,Theorn, is a fisherman of the Lake and has his own boat. Already at a young age Fairn started to do various chores, mending nets and emptying buckets of fish-gut. As he grew up he started to dream of something better, to make a living as a travelling bard. When the daughter of a local merchant caught his eye things rapidly started to change. After a brief and passionate encounter , her father decided his daughter was not to marry a poor fisherman. With the help of his hired sword-hands, he ran Fairn out of town.

Fairn took it as a sign that it was time to do something with his life. He bought a horse with supplies, wrote his farewells to the family back in Lake-town, and started on a journey eastwards. Had he known how arduous the journey would be, he would never have left. When he reached the great forest of Mirkwood, he was lucky to get an escort of wood-elves , along the northern trail. But the Misty Mountains almost claimed his life. Trying to traverse the High Pass, in mid winter was a folly. Lost in a blizzard he managed to make it down the mountain, but still on the eastern side. He followed the Anduin south and it wasn’t until he tried the Red Horn pass, that he managed to make it across. The elves in Eregion was kind enough to help him and after a long journey through Trollshaws and the Lonelands, he finally reached Bree.
